A uniform magnetic field exists in the plane of paper pointing from left to right as shown in figure. In the field, an electron and a proton move as shown. The electron and the proton experience:

A

Forces both pointing into the plane of paper

B

Forces both pointing out the plane of paper

C

Forces pointing into the plane of paper and out of the plane of paper, respectively

D

Forece pointing opposite and along the direction of the uniform magnetic field respectively

Text Solution

Verified by Experts

The correct Answer is:
A

In the given figure, the proton and electron are moving in opposite direction to each other and in perpendicular to the direction of magnetic field. Now, we know that, the direction of current is taken opposite to the direction of motion of electron.
So, both electron and proton has currect in same direction. Therefore the focees acting on it is given by Fleming's left hand rule and they are pointing into the plane of the paper.
